5.80 NITROUS DOORSLAMMERS?

The recent five second runs by Jim Halsey and Mike Castellana might
just be scratching the surface of the newfound performance increases by
nitrous doorslammers, this according to their respective engine
builders. Gene Fulton and David Reher admit newfound gains in the
five-inch bore spaced, nitrous-injected engines will quickly propel the
bottle rockets through the 5.9-second realm and into the 5.80s at a
rapid rate.

According to Fulton, engine builder for Halsey, the 5.80s are already
in the bag and if the season were one month longer, we’d see them.

“Nitrous Pro Modified still has piece to go and it can go quite a bit
further,” Fulton added. “It’s just a matter whether there are people
mechanically inclined enough to make it happen and people financed
enough.”

FLYNN TO BERNSTEIN

Kenny Bernstein has confirmed that Rob Flynn will take over as crew
chief on the Budweiser/Lucas Oil dragster at the end of the season. 
Flynn will be accompanied by Mike Guger, who has been named assistant
crew chief.

The duo will replace Tim and Kim Richards who have announced their retirement from the sport at the end of the year.

“Sometimes timing is everything,” said Bernstein.  “It was a whirlwind
weekend at Richmond. When Tim and Kim told us of their decision to make
this year their last, suddenly Rob and Mike became available.  The
pieces of the puzzle just began to fit together.

“We are excited to welcome them to our Budweiser/Lucas Oil team. It
will be our first opportunity to work with Rob, and of course, Mike has
spent several years with our team in the past. They have proven that
they can win races and nearly won the championship last year, so we’re
very optimistic that we can continue to field a highly competitive team
for Budweiser, Lucas Oil, Mac Tools, and all our sponsors.”

RON CAPPS TO DRIVE NAPA NASCAR LATE MODEL IN CALIFORNIA OCT. 25

Ron Capps, whose regular mount is the 7000-horsepower NAPA AUTO PARTS
Dodge Charger R/T Funny Car in the NHRA POWERade Drag Racing Series,
will drive a NAPA-sponsored NASCAR Late Model in a companion event to
the NASCAR Camping World Series championship finale in Roseville,
Calif., on Oct. 25.

Capps, who is seventh in the NHRA Countdown to 1 championship chase
with two events remaining in the 2008 season, will also act as a Grand
Marshal for the night's event at the paved one-third-mile oval at All
American Speedway.

He will drive a car owned by NCWS team owner Bill McAnally in the
NASCAR Whelen All American Series, in his first stab at competing in an
official NASCAR event. Capps has driven Late Models, Sprint cars,
Midgets, open-wheeled sports cars, and tested IROC cars in his career,
while competing regularly as a professional Funny Car racer since 1997.

GOODGUYS 2009 SCHEDULE

The Goodguys Rod & Custom Association, the largest rod & custom
association in the world with over 70,000 members, will stage
twenty-two events in 2009. The event lineup features eighteen national
events for rods, customs, classics and muscle cars through 1972 vintage
as well as four “Get-Together's” in California which welcome all years,
makes and models of specialty vehicles.

The Goodguys 2009 event season kicks off March 14 & 15 with the 3rd
Meguiar’s Orange County Get-Together at the OC Fair & Expo Center
in Costa Mesa, CA. The season wraps November 20, 21 & 22 in
Scottsdale, AZ for the season-ending 12th Southwest Nationals at
Westworld.

Notable date changes include the 18th East Coast Nationals in
Rhinebeck, New York which has been moved from its traditional September
date to June 26, 27 & 28. The event will remain at the historic
Dutchess County Fairgrounds. The 8th Blue Suede Cruise will take place
August 28, 29 & 30 at Summit Motorsports Park in Norwalk, Ohio.

TF MOTORCYCLE OVER 250

A national record fell and a milestone was passed at the AMA Dragbike
Fall Nationals at Summit Motorsports Park with the first-ever 250 mph
pass in Top Fuel motorcycle.

Top Fuel motorcycle rider Korry Hogan of Denver, Colo., made the first
250 mile per hour run in history on a motorcycle. The record-setting
pass came in the second round of qualifying of the AMA Dragbike Fall
Nationals on Saturday, October 11.
